LEADERSHIP REVIEW BRIEFING — Sales Leads

Quick heads-up before Thursday: the Brightline Rewards overhaul is further along than most of you think. Points are out, tier perks are in, and the Fennick pilot showed redemption costs dropping nicely. Roll-out timing still depends on the app refresh from Odette's team. What this really means for next year is captured in the confidential note below.

board note of bawep-tajef: Queniusek Systems plans to raise the Quenvan list price by 53.1 percent in March. The pricing group signed off on a budget of $176.4 million for Project Drueth. The renewal with Casionix Partners closes at $142.5 million a year, 8.3 percent below the last contract. Project Fraax slips by six weeks because of the tooling delay.

**Q: How do I get onto the new Level 6 floor at Hollybrook House?**

A: Level 6 opens to staff next Monday. New starters based there should take the east lifts, as the west lifts won't stop at 6 until the reader installation finishes. Your standard badge will work on the main doors from day one. The kitchen and quiet rooms use a separate keypad during the opening fortnight; the temporary code is below.

turnstile pass: bdg-QZV-3

## Deployment

SpokeShift is the rebalancing scheduler for the Velloway bike-share network. It ships as a single container and expects a Postgres instance plus the Velloway station-feed poller to be reachable at startup. Deploy via the standard Harbormark pipeline; staging runs in the Dunmore cluster, production in Ketler. Reviewers should confirm that the dry-run flag is disabled only in production and that rebalancing windows match the ops calendar. The service reads the following configuration at boot.

config for kafof-bawef:
holath:
  log_level: debug
  metrics_host: metrics.holath.qorvelsys.internal
  pin: 2191
  pool_size: 32

Snapshot tests for Driftboard components run in the Mirrorline CI stage. If the stage fails, first check whether the failure is a legitimate regression or a stale snapshot from a recent design-token change. Do not blindly regenerate snapshots; diff them in the Mirrorline viewer and confirm with the owning team. Regeneration requires the update flag plus a clean working tree. The viewer pulls baseline images from the artifact store, which requires authentication, and the next line sets the token it uses.

vault entry, kafog-yahop: COURIER_KEY8=0faa53ae